| #define PSA_EXPORT_KEY_PAIR_MAX_SIZE 0 | 
Sufficient buffer size for exporting any asymmetric key pair.
This value must be a sufficient buffer size when calling psa_export_key() to export any asymmetric key pair that is supported by the implementation, regardless of the exact key type and key size.
See also PSA_EXPORT_KEY_OUTPUT_SIZE().
| #define PSA_EXPORT_PUBLIC_KEY_MAX_SIZE 0 | 
Sufficient buffer size for exporting any asymmetric public key.
This macro expands to a compile-time constant integer. This value is a sufficient buffer size when calling psa_export_key() or psa_export_public_key() to export any asymmetric public key, regardless of the exact key type and key size.
See also PSA_EXPORT_PUBLIC_KEY_OUTPUT_SIZE(key_type, key_bits).
